1. University of Winnipeg
The University of Winnipeg is one of the top public universities in Canada, where students can study without IELTS. Although English is the language of instruction, applicants from non-English-speaking countries must prove their language proficiency by submitting alternative test scores or completing academic English programs.
Accepted alternatives to IELTS are:
- Duolingo English Test – Minimum score: 120
- TOEFL iBT – Minimum score: 86 with at least 20 in each component
- Cambridge C1 Advanced or C2 Proficiency – Minimum score: 180
- CAEL/CAEL CE/CAEL Online – Minimum score: 60–70
- Pearson Test of English (Academic) – Minimum score: 58
- Academic English Program from University and College Entrance (AEPUCE) – Successful completion
- English Language Program (ELP) – Completion of Academic Level 5 or C+ in Academic Writing 1 and 2
Students can also apply for a waiver of the English Language Requirement by contacting the admissions office.
2. University of Saskatchewan
The University of Saskatchewan (USask) accepts international students for master’s and PhD programs without IELTS. However, if your first language is not English, you must submit proof of English language proficiency. If you don’t meet the requirement, you can complete the U-PREP course before beginning your degree.
Minimum scores required:
- TOEFL iBT – 86 overall with 19 in each section
- Cambridge C1 Advanced – 176 minimum
- Duolingo English Test – Overall 115 with a minimum of 95 in each area
- PTE Academic – Overall 63 with no less than 59
- CAEL – 70% overall with 60% per section
- Completion of the University of Saskatchewan Language Centre Level 4 (graduate bridging)
- Completion of the University of Regina Intensive ESL Advanced Level (ESL 50)
Other options include submitting GCE, IB, and AP English qualifications.
3. Cambrian College
Cambrian College is a leading public institution in Northern Ontario, offering career-focused programs. You can study at Cambrian College without IELTS if you provide alternate test scores or complete an English preparatory course.
Accepted English proficiency tests:
- TOEFL (iBT) – 80 for Diploma/Certificate; 84 for Grad Certificate; 88 for Degrees
- TOEFL (Paper-based) – 550 to 570
- PTE – 58 to 6,1 depending on the program
- Duolingo – 105 to 115 for Diploma/Certificate; 120+ for Grad Certificate
- English for Academic Purposes Program (EAPP) – Completion accepted
4. Seneca College
Seneca College is one of the most popular colleges for international students in Ontario. IELTS is not compulsory here. You can provide test scores taken within the last two years.
Accepted alternatives:
- TOEFL iBT – Minimum 80 (no section below 20)
- CAEL CE and CAEL Online – Minimum score of 60
- PTE Academic – Minimum score: 58
- Cambridge English (FCE, CAE, or CPE) – Overall 169 with no band below 162
Students from specific English-speaking countries are exempt from submitting English language test scores.
5. Brock University
Brock University uses English as the medium of instruction. International students must prove their English language proficiency if their first language is not English. IELTS is not the only option.
Accepted tests:
- TOEFL, CAEL, Duolingo, MELAB, YELT
- Students can also take Brock University’s Intensive English Language Program (IELP)
6. Memorial University of Newfoundland and Labrador
Memorial University is a respected institution in Atlantic Canada. You can study here without IELTS if you take other recognised tests or complete the ESL program offered by the university.
Accepted alternatives:
- TOEFL iBT – Minimum 79
- Duolingo – Minimum 115
- CAEL – 50 to 60
- Cambridge English – 176 minimum
- CanTEST – 4.5
- PTE – Minimum 58
- MET – Minimum 59
Note: Bachelor of Engineering has separate English language score requirements.
7. Okanagan College
Okanagan College offers admission to international students without IELTS. Students from British Columbia high schools can use their English 12 grade as proof of proficiency.
Accepted options:
- Duolingo English Test
- TOEFL iBT
- OCELA (Okanagan College English Language Assessment)
Minimum scores depend on the program applied for.
8. University of Guelph
The University of Guelph allows students to submit alternative English proficiency test scores instead of IELTS. The university also accepts its in-house English Language Certificate Program (ELCP) for meeting requirements.
Accepted alternatives:
- TOEFL iBT – Minimum 89
- Duolingo – Minimum 110
- PTE Academic – Minimum 60
- CAEL – Minimum 70
- Cambridge English (C1/C2) – 176 overall, no band below 169
- ELCP – Level 9 and 10 required
9. McGill University
McGill University is one of Canada’s most prestigious universities. IELTS is not required if the applicant submits a TOEFL score or has completed a degree in an English-medium institution.
Minimum TOEFL requirement:
- TOEFL iBT – Minimum score: 100 (with no section less than 20)
Only results from certified test centres are accepted. McGill’s ETS code is 0935.
10. Algoma University
At Algoma University, international students can apply to Diploma, Undergraduate, and Postgraduate programs without IELTS. You must show proof of English proficiency using one of the accepted methods.
Accepted tests:
- TOEFL iBT – 79
- CAEL – 60
- PTE – 60
- Duolingo – Overall 110 with no band below 90
- Cambridge English – 176 overall, 169 per band
Students with ENG4U (OSSD) or ENGL12 (BC) – 3 years with a minimum of 70% may qualify for a waiver.
11. Brandon University
Brandon University requires all students to prove English language proficiency. IELTS is not compulsory if you submit equivalent tests and meet the minimum score.
Accepted options:
- TOEFL iBT – 80
- CAEL – 60
- Duolingo – 110
- PTE – 58
- Cambridge English (C1 or C2) – 176
- CanTEST – 4.5 in Reading/Listening and 4.0 in Speaking/Writing
Documents must be sent directly from the issuing institution.
12. Carleton University
Carleton University accepts students without IELTS, especially at the graduate level. If you have studied in English or meet the required scores in other tests, you do not need IELTS.
Requirements:
- TOEFL iBT – Total score of 100 with a minimum of 24 in each area
- CAEL – Overall band score of 70 or higher
- Applicants from English-medium institutions can submit the Confirmation of Language Proficiency Form.
13. University of Regina
The University of Regina allows students to study without IELTS if they meet alternative test score requirements or complete the in-house ESL course.
Accepted alternatives:
- TOEFL iBT – Minimum 20 per skill
- CAEL – 70
- PTE – 59
- CanTEST – 4.5 overall, 4.0 in each skill
- MELAB – 80
- Completion of Advanced EAP 050 accepted

How to Study in Canada Without IELTS?
Yes, candidates can apply to Canadian universities without IELTS. They just need to follow some basic steps to meet the English language requirements. Most Canadian universities accept other standardised English tests. Some may offer an internal language program before the main course.
To study in Canada without IELTS, the following steps need to be followed:
- Check if the university accepts students without IELTS. The list of top 15 universities in Canada without IELTS is mentioned in the article above, one can refer to the list.
- Choose an alternative English proficiency test like TOEFL, CAEL, PTE, Duolingo, or Cambridge English. 100% of universities in Canada accept TOEFL as the English language proficiency test.
- Check the minimum English proficiency test score required by the university, as it varies for each course and level of study.
- If you don’t want to take any test, check if the university accepts proof of English-medium education for 3 or 4 years.
- Some universities allow students to enrol in their English Language Pathway Program or ESL course. You must complete this before starting your academic program.
- Students from exempt countries may not need to submit any test scores. Check with the admissions office.
- One has to submit all of their official documents, including test scores, school transcripts, and a passport copy, before the deadline.
- After a successful review, the university will issue the letter of acceptance.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I get admission in Canada without IELTS?
Yes. Candidates can apply to Canadian universities without IELTS. One just needs to provide alternative English test scores like TOEFL, PTE, CAEL, or Duolingo. Many Canadian universities allow even English English-medium certificate as proof.
What test can I take instead of IELTS for Canada?
There are various English proficiency tests, one can give to study in Canada. Some of the popular English proficiency tests, which are the best alternative to IELTS to study in Canada, are:
- TOEFL iBT
- Pearson Test of English (PTE)
- Duolingo English Test (DET)
- Canadian Academic English Language Assessment (CAEL)
- Cambridge English Exams (C1 Advanced, C2 Proficiency)
- CanTEST
- CELPIP
Is it possible to get a study visa without IELTS?
Yes. If you get admission without IELTS and the university issues the letter of acceptance, you can apply for a study visa. The Canadian visa is approved if your university accepts other language tests.
Do Canadian universities accept the Duolingo English test?
Yes. Most Canadian universities and colleges now accept Duolingo. The minimum score is between 105 and 125. The score depends on the course and level of study.
Can I submit TOEFL for admission instead of IELTS?
Yes. TOEFL is accepted in Canadian universities for UG and PG admissions. You can submit TOEFL iBT score instead of IELTS for visa and university application.
Can Indian students go to Canada without IELTS?
Yes. Indian students can apply and study in Canada without IELTS. They can take the TOEFL, CAEL, PTE, Cambridge English test, or Duolingo. A student from English English-medium background can also request an exemption.
Can I apply with English medium certificate only?
Yes. Some universities accept students with 3 or 4 years of English-medium education. A certificate from your school or college is needed as proof. Some universities also conduct interviews.
Do all Canadian universities require IELTS?
No. Many universities do not require IELTS. Some accept other test scores, some allow English preparatory programs, and some give IELTS waivers for English-medium students.
Is there any in-house English program in Canada?
Yes. Universities like the University of Winnipeg, Brock, and Regina have in-house English courses like AEPUCE, IELP, and EAP. If you don’t have a test score, you can take these programs before the main course.
What Duolingo score is needed for Canada?
Duolingo score needed is:
- 105–115 for diploma and certificate courses
- 115–125 for graduate certificate or master’s
- Some programs may accept 100+ if the English interview is passed
Can I apply for Canada with PTE score?
Yes. PTE Academic is accepted in many Canadian institutions. The minimum PTE score is between 58 and 65, depending on the course. PTE is also accepted for a visa in most cases.
Can I study in Canada without taking any English test?
Yes. If you are from an English-speaking country or studied in English for 3 to 4 years, you can get admission without any test. You must show a valid certificate of English medium education.
